terminal velocity = sqrt(2mg/pACd)
where m = 92.4N (assuming 907kg kerb weight)
g = 9.81
p = density of air = 1.2kg/m3
A = cross sectional area ( i can only find ffrontal area) = 1.91
Cd = drag coeff = 0.36
therefore:
terminal velocity = sqrt(1812.888/0.82512) = sqrt(2197.12) = 46.87ms
46.87ms = 104mph
so you can actually drive your car faster than you can drop it.
